Biochimie is a monthly peer-reviewed scientific journal covering the fields of biochemistry, biophysics, and molecular biology. It is published by Elsevier on behalf of the .[1] [2] The journal, started as a French language publication, is also open to English language articles since the late 2000s., the editor-in-chief is Bertrand Friguet, succeeding Richard H. Buckingham.[3]
The journal was established in 1914 under the title Bulletin de la Société de Chimie Biologique, obtaining its current title in 1971.[4] [5]
The journal is abstracted and indexed in:According to the Journal Citation Reports, the journal has a 2021 impact factor of 4.372.[6]
